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•All children who attend the Mother and Child Health (MCH) clinic for their second Diphtheria, Pertussis, Tetanus (DPT) and polio immunisations and who are permanent residents in the study area of Ifakara town.
Exclusion Criteria
- •Infants who are not permanent residents in Ifakara.
